How much do inbound logistics man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for inbound logistics manager in Ohio is $72,539.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,700.00 and $86,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an inbound logistics manager do?

An Inbound Logistics Manager oversees the process of receiving, storing, and distributing incoming goods and materials in a company. They coordinate with suppliers, manage transportation schedules, and ensure that inventory levels are maintained to meet production needs. Their responsibilities include negotiating with vendors, optimizing supply chain efficiency, and implementing cost-saving strategies. Effective inbound logistics management helps businesses reduce delays, lower costs, and improve overall operational performance.

What are some typical challenges faced by inbound logistics managers when coordinating with suppliers and carriers?

Inbound Logistics Managers often encounter challenges such as delays in shipments, inconsistent supplier communication, and fluctuating transportation costs. Navigating these issues requires strong problem-solving skills and proactive relationship management to ensure materials arrive on time and within budget. Collaboration with procurement, warehouse teams, and external partners is key to maintaining a smooth supply chain and quickly addressing any disruptions that may arise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an inbound logistics manager?

To thrive as an Inbound Logistics Manager, you need strong supply chain management knowledge, data analysis skills, and a degree in logistics, business, or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, transportation management software, and relevant certifications like APICS or CSCP is often required. Leadership,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for managing teams and coordinating with suppliers. These skills and qualities are vital for optimizing supply chain efficiency, reducing costs, and ensuring timely delivery of goods.

Job Description

This is a hybrid role in Perrysburg, Ohio. 

The Senior Inbound Material Planner is a strategic, plant-integrated supply chain leader responsible for end-to-end ownership of inbound raw material planning, execution, and system enablement across multiple manufacturing sites. This role combines deep plant operations expertise with advanced planning capabilities to optimize material flow, inventory strategy, and ERP system utilization.

This position is uniquely critical in bridging corporate supply chain strategy with real-time plant execution. Leveraging firsthand experience in plant operations including B&F Management. The Senior Planner will lead the design, implementation, and continuous improvement of material forecasting, MRP functionality, and SAP-based ordering processes.

As a key driver of transformation, this role will serve as the primary change agent for inbound material planning standardization across the network, ensuring practical, plant-aligned solutions that are scalable, efficient, and sustainable. The Senior Planner will also take on a broader and more complex material scope than peers, including high-variability and strategic materials such as cullet.

Responsibilities: 

  • Strategic Material Planning & MRP Enablement:
    • Co-lead the implementation and optimization of SAP-based material forecasting and automated order placement (MRP) across the network.
    • Translate plant-level operational realities into system design requirements to ensure accurate planning parameters (lead times, consumption rates, safety stock, etc.).
  • End-to-End Material Ownership:
    • Manage demand planning, order placement, and scheduling alignment for inbound materials across multiple plants.
    • Serve as subject matter expert for raw material receiving and consumption across the network.
    • Oversee complex material categories (e.g., cullet), including supply balancing, demand shaping, and supplier collaboration.
    • Drive proactive decision-making to maintain optimal inventory days’ supply while mitigating risk of shortages or excess.
  • Plant Partnership & Change Management
    • Serve as the primary bridge between corporate supply chain and plant operations, ensuring alignment, credibility, and trust across stakeholders.
    • Leverage firsthand plant experience and established relationships with suppliers and carriers to proactively manage supply risks, influence performance, and resolve constraints.
    • Lead the onboarding of plants into standardized inbound planning processes and SAP/MRP adoption, ensuring solutions are practical and aligned with real-world operations.
    • Provide guidance and challenge plant assumptions regarding material demand, usage, and constraints based on data and operational insight.
  • Advanced Inventory & Supply Optimization
    • Partner with global teams to develop and refine inventory strategies, such as safety stock, that account for plant consumption variability, furnace operations, and raw material constraints.
    • Continuously optimize inbound logistics, including rail/truck scheduling, to minimize total landed cost and operational disruption.
  • Cross-Functional Expertise & Team Development
    • Mentor and upskill other planners by sharing deep knowledge of plant operations, material consumption, and physical process constraints.
    • Provide subject matter expertise on furnace operations, batch processes, and material flow complexities to enhance team decision-making.
Qualifications
  • Proven experience in purchasing, transportation management, supply chain management, and glass furnace operations (required).
  • Experience in SAP or another ERP software (required).
  •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ain Management, Business Administration, Engineering, or related field (preferred).
  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to collaborate effectively with internal and external partners.
  • 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
  • Detail oriented with a focus on accuracy and efficiency.
